Comprehending Door Windows

Door windows come in different designs, materials, and configurations. To understand the replacement procedure much better, it is vital to value their essential features and functions:

Types of Door Windows

  • Fixed Sidelights: These are non-operable windows that stay closed and offer a view and light.

  • Operable Sidelights: These can open for ventilation, offering not just light but also air flow to boost convenience.

  • Transom Windows: Positioned above the door, these windows can complement sidelight windows and add height to the entryway.

  • Decorative Glass: Often utilized for aesthetic functions, ornamental glass sidelights can include stained glass or patterned styles.

Materials

  • Vinyl: Durable and low-maintenance, vinyl windows are energy-efficient and be available in numerous designs.

  • Fiberglass: Offering outstanding insulating properties, fiberglass windows are resistant to warping and can mimic wood's appearance.

  • Wood: A standard option, wood windows offer natural charm but require routine maintenance to avoid rot and warping.

  • Aluminum: Lightweight and strong, aluminumframes are resistant to deterioration however might not provide the best insulation.

Benefits of Replacing Door Windows

Replacing door windows offers numerous advantages for house owners:

  • Energy Efficiency: Aging windows typically lose their insulating residential or commercial properties, leading to increased energy costs. Newer windows are designed to decrease heat loss and gain.

  • Boosted Curb Appeal: Updating door windows can considerably improve the exterior look of a home without the need for significant remodellings.

  • Increased Home Value: Well-maintained and aesthetically pleasing door windows can increase a home's market worth.

  • Noise Reduction: New window innovations supply much better sound insulation, producing a quieter indoor environment.

Steps for Door Windows Replacement

The replacement of door windows includes a number of crucial actions that house owners must follow to guarantee a successful outcome:

  1. Assessment and Measure: Evaluate the existing window condition and measure the size precisely.

  2. Pick Replacement Windows: Choose the proper type and product based upon individual preference and climate considerations.

  3. Gather Required Tools and Materials: Compile all needed tools (e.g., screwdriver, caulk gun, level) and products for the replacement.

  4. Get Rid Of the Old Window:

    • Safety Precautions: Wear protective equipment such as gloves and shatterproof glass to prevent injuries.
    • Remove Trim: Use an energy knife to thoroughly cut through paint or caulk adhering the trim to the wall.
    • Remove the Window: Pull out the old window frame gently, bewaring to not harm the door structure.
  5. Prepare the Opening: Clean the window opening, looking for any damage to the frame or surrounding product. Repair as essential.

  6. Set Up the New Window:

    • Set the Window: Insert the new window into the opening and ensure it sits level and plumb.
    • Secure: Secure the window using screws or fasteners provided by the producer.
    • Seal: Apply caulk around the edges to produce a water resistant seal and improve insulation.
  7. Include Trim: Reinstall or replace the trim around the new window to end up the appearance effortlessly.

  8. Final Inspection: Check that the window opens and closes appropriately and that there are no gaps or leaks.

FAQs About Door Windows Replacement

Q: How do I know if I require to replace my door windows?A: Signs that replacements are essential include visible condensation in between panes, fractures in the glass, draftiness, or significant trouble in opening/closing the window.

Q: Can I replace door windows myself?A: While it's possible for property owners with DIY experience to change door windows, working with an expert ensures correct installation and reduces the threat of issues in the future. Q: What is the typical

expense of replacing door windows?A: The expense can differ significantly based upon size, product, and labor, but average replacement costs can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 800 per window. Q: How long does it require to change door windows?A: The replacement procedure can take a couple of

hours to a complete day, depending on the complexity of the installation and whether additional repairs are needed. Q: Are energy-efficient doors worth the investment?A: Yes, energy-efficient doors can substantially decrease energy costs

gradually, offsetting the preliminary financial investment,
especially in areas with extreme climates.
